California Supplemental Tax Regulations for Google (Alphabet) RSUs

California Franchise Tax Board (FTB) mandates a 10.23% flat supplemental withholding rate for equity compensation. Because California top marginal rates reach 13.3% (plus 1.1% uncapped CASDI for wage bases), high earners frequently face a substantial 3.0%–4.0% state tax gap on April 15.

California Safe Harbor & Underpayment Penalties

Pay 110% of prior year CA tax or 90% of current year liability to eliminate underpayment penalties.

Employer Stock Plan Specifics: Charles Schwab / Morgan Stanley

Google utilizes a frontloaded monthly vesting schedule (33% across years 1 and 2). Because monthly vests are treated as supplemental wage distributions, Schwab withholds federal tax at flat 22%. Googlers with total comp above $350k find that each monthly tranche underwithholds by 10% to 15%, compounding silently over 12 months.

When vesting at Google (Alphabet), Charles Schwab / Morgan Stanley calculates automatic sell-to-cover withholding using California's statutory supplemental rate of 10.23% combined with the federal supplemental rate (22% on up to $1M). Because top earners in California reach marginal brackets exceeding these rates, you will face an incremental shortfall on April 15.
